< Genesis 18 >

1 And he appeared to him Yahweh at [the] great trees of Mamre and he [was] sitting [the] opening of the tent when [the] heat of the day.
Yawe abimelaki Abrayami pene ya banzete minene ya Mamire, wana avandaki na ekotelo ya ndako na ye ya kapo, na moyi makasi ya midi.
2 And he lifted up eyes his and he saw and there! three men [were] standing with him and he saw and he ran to meet them from [the] opening of the tent and he bowed down [the] ground towards.
Tango Abrayami atombolaki miso, amonaki mibali misato pene na ye. Mpe tango kaka amonaki bango, atelemaki wuta na ndako na ye ya kapo mpe akendeki mbangu mpo na kokutana na bango; bongo agumbamaki kino na mabele.
3 And he said Lord my if please I have found favor in view your may not please you pass by from with servant your.
Alobaki: — Nabondeli bino, bankolo na ngai, soki nazwi ngolu na miso bino, boleka mosali na bino te.
4 Let it be brought please a little of water and wash feet your and support yourself under the tree.
Tika ete namemela bino mwa mayi mpo ete bokoka kosukola makolo mpe bopema na se ya nzete oyo.
5 So let me bring a piece of bread and sustain heart your (after *L(S)*) you will pass on for since you have passed by at servant your and they said thus you will do just as you have said.
Tika ete namemela bino mwa eloko ya kolia mpo ete bozwa lisusu makasi na nzoto; bongo bokokoba mobembo na bino, pamba te ezali mpo na yango nde boleki epai na ngai mosali na bino. Bazongisaki: — Ezali malamu, sala ndenge olobi.
6 And he hurried Abraham the tent towards to Sarah and he said bring quickly three seahs flour fine flour knead [it] and make bread cakes.
Abrayami akotaki na lombangu na ndako na ye ya kapo mpe alobaki na Sara: « Kamata katini misato ya farine mpe sala bagato na lombangu. »
7 And to the herd he ran Abraham and he took a young one of [the] herd tender and good and he gave [it] to the servant and he hurried to prepare it.
Mpe Abrayami apotaki mbangu na lopango ya bibwele, azwaki mwana ngombe ya mafuta mpe apesaki yango na mosali na ye mpo ete alamba yango noki-noki.
8 And he brought curd and milk and [the] young one of the herd which he had prepared and he set [it] before them and he [was] standing with them under the tree and they ate.
Azwaki mafuta ya ngombe, miliki mpe mosuni oyo alambaki, mpe atiaki yango liboso na bango. Abrayami atelemaki pembeni na bango, na se ya nzete, wana bazalaki kolia.
9 And they said to him where? [is] Sarah wife your and he said there! in the tent.
Sima, batunaki ye: — Wapi Sara, mwasi na yo? Abrayami azongisaki: — Azali na ndako.
10 And he said certainly I will return to you about the time living and there! a son [will belong] to Sarah wife your and Sarah [was] listening [the] opening of the tent and it [was] behind him.
Bongo moko kati na bango alobaki: — Solo, na mobu oyo ezali koya, kaka na eleko oyo, nakozonga epai na yo, mpe Sara, mwasi na yo, akozala na mwana mobali. Nzokande, Sara ayokaki maloba wana na ekotelo ya ndako ya kapo, na sima ya Abrayami.
11 And Abraham and Sarah [were] old [having] come in days it had ceased to be to Sarah a way like women.
Abrayami mpe Sara bazalaki mibange, mpo ete bakomaki na mibu ebele penza mpe Sara azalaki lisusu na makoki te ya kobota.
12 And she laughed Sarah in inner being her saying after am worn out I has it be[longed]? to me pleasure and lord my he is old.
Sara asekaki mpe amilobelaki: « Awa nasili konuna boye, nakoki lisusu koyoka posa ya mobali? Kutu nkolo na ngai akomi mpe mobange! »
13 And he said Yahweh to Abraham why? this did she laugh Sarah saying ¿ also really will I bear a child and I I am old.
Yawe alobaki na Abrayami: — Mpo na nini Sara aseki mpe alobi: « Nakoki solo kobota mwana awa nasili kokoma mobange? »
14 ¿ Is it [too] difficult for Yahweh anything to the appointed time I will return to you about the time living and [will belong] to Sarah a son.
Boni, ezali na eloko oyo Yawe akoki kolembana? Na mobu oyo ezali koya, na tango oyo ekatama, kaka na eleko oyo, nakozonga epai na yo, mpe Sara akozala na mwana mobali.
15 And she denied Sarah - saying not I laughed for - she was afraid and he said - In-deed you laughed.
Sara abangaki; boye awanganaki: — Naseki te. Kasi Yawe alobaki: — Ezali ya solo, oseki.
16 And they arose from there the men and they looked down on [the] face of Sodom and Abraham [was] walking with them to send off them.
Tango mibali yango batelemaki mpo na kokoba mobembo na bango na Sodome, Abrayami akendeki kotika bango na nzela.
17 And Yahweh he said ¿ [be] concealing [will] I from Abraham [that] which I [am] about to do.
Yawe amilobelaki: « Boni, nakoki solo kobombela Abrayami likambo oyo nalingi kosala?
18 And Abraham certainly he will become a nation great and mighty and they will be blessed by him all [the] nations of the earth.
Solo, Abrayami akokoma ekolo monene mpe ya nguya, mpe bato ya bikolo nyonso ya mabele bakomipambola mpo na ye.
19 For I have known him so that that he may command children his and household his after him and they will keep [the] way of Yahweh by doing righteousness and justice so that will bring Yahweh on Abraham [that] which he has spoken on him.
Pamba te naponaki ye mpo ete ateya bana na ye mpe ndako na ye sima na ye ete bayeba kobatela nzela ya Yawe na kozalaka na etamboli ya malamu mpe ya sembo; na bongo nde, Ngai Yawe, nakokokisela Abrayami elaka oyo napesaki ye. »
20 And he said Yahweh [the] outcry of Sodom and Gomorrah for it is great and sin their that it is heavy exceedingly.
Bongo Yawe alobaki: « Nayoki sango ete mabe ya bato ya Sodome mpe ya Gomore eleki ndelo, mpe masumu na bango eleki mingi penza.
21 I will go down please so I may see ¿ according to outcry its that has come to me have they done - completion and if not I will know.
Nakokita mpo na kotala soki makambo oyo bazali kosala ekokani na oyo Ngai nayoki. Soki ezali bongo te, nakoyeba. »
22 And they turned away from there the men and they went Sodom towards (and Abraham *L(S)*) still [was] he standing before (Yahweh. *L(S)*)
Mibali yango babalukaki mpe bakendeki na Sodome, kasi Abrayami atelemaki kaka liboso ya Yawe.
23 And he drew near Abraham and he said ¿ also will you sweep away [the] righteous with [the] wicked.
Bongo Abrayami apusanaki mpe alobaki: — Boni, Nkolo na ngai, okoboma penza elongo moto ya sembo mpe moto mabe?
24 Perhaps there [are] fifty righteous [people] in [the] midst of the city ¿ also will you sweep [it] away and not will you forgive? the place for [the] sake of fifty the righteous [people] who [are] in midst its.
Soki bato ya sembo bazali tuku mitano kati na engumba, okoboma bango kaka? Okolimbisa engumba yango te mpo na bato ya sembo tuku mitano oyo bazali kati na yango?
25 Far be it to you from doing - according to the manner this to put to death [the] righteous with [the] wicked and it will be as the righteous [person] as the wicked [person] far be it to you ¿ [the] judge of all the earth not will he do justice.
Te, okoki kosala likambo ya boye te! Okoki te koboma elongo bato ya sembo mpe bato mabe, okoki kosala ndenge moko te na bato ya sembo mpe na bato mabe. Okoki kosala bongo te! Boni, Mosambisi ya mokili mobimba akosambisa na bosembo te?
26 And he said Yahweh if I will find in Sodom fifty righteous [people] in [the] midst of the city and I will forgive all the place for sake of them.
Yawe azongisaki: — Soki nakuti na Sodome bato ya sembo tuku mitano, nakolimbisa engumba mobimba mpo na bango.
27 And he answered Abraham and he said here! please I have undertaken to speak to [the] Lord and I [am] dust and ash[es].
Abrayami alobaki lisusu: — Solo, nazali na ngai moto pamba mpe putulu, kasi limbisa ete nameka kosolola na Nkolo na ngai.
28 Perhaps they will lack! fifty the righteous [people] five ¿ will you destroy for five all the city and he said not I will destroy [it] if I will find there forty and five.
Bongo soki motango na bato ya sembo ezali tuku minei na mitano? Boni, okobebisa engumba mobimba mpo na bato mitano oyo bazangi? Yawe azongisaki: — Soki nakuti bato ya sembo tuku minei na mitano, nakobebisa yango te.
29 And he repeated again to speak to him and he said perhaps they will be found! there forty and he said not I will do [it] for sake of the forty.
Abrayami alobaki na Ye lisusu: — Bongo soki bato ya sembo bazali kaka tuku minei? Azongisaki: — Soki bazali kaka tuku minei, nakobebisa yango te.
30 And he said may not please it burn to [the] Lord and let me speak perhaps they will be found! there thirty and he said not I will do [it] if I will find there thirty.
Bongo Abrayami alobaki: — Tika ete Nkolo na ngai asilika te soki nakobi koloba: Bongo soki bato ya sembo bazali kaka tuku misato? Azongisaki: — Soki nakuti bato ya sembo tuku misato, nakobebisa yango te.
31 And he said here! please I have undertaken to speak to [the] Lord perhaps they will be found! there twenty and he said not I will destroy [it] for sake of the twenty.
Abrayami alobaki: —Awa nameki kosolola na Nkolo, boni, okosala nini soki bato ya sembo bazali kaka tuku mibale? Azongisaki: — Mpo na bato ya sembo tuku mibale, nakobebisa engumba te.
32 And he said may not please it burn to [the] Lord and let me speak only this time perhaps they will be found! there ten and he said not I will destroy [it] for sake of the ten.
Bongo Abrayami alobaki: — Tika ete Nkolo na ngai asilika te, pamba te nazali koloba mpo na mbala ya suka: Bongo soki bato ya sembo bazali kaka zomi? Azongisaki: — Mpo na bato ya sembo zomi, nakobebisa engumba te.
33 And he went Yahweh just as he had finished to speak to Abraham and Abraham he returned to place his.
Sima na Yawe kosolola na Abrayami, akendeki; mpe Abrayami azongaki na ndako na ye.
